After months, and months, and then a couple more months, I've finally driven the Valiant. Long story short, finally bought a replacement fender for the passenger side from Dr. Mopar down here in Central Texas today and installed it...banged out some of the hood damage to where it will close, spun the old slant 6 over and BAM, she started right up.

First time she's actually been driven, other than around the parking lot at the storage facility, in a few years. Did pretty well, although the fuel filter doesn't seem to be filling up, only shows a trickle of fuel.....and the temp gauge goes to HOT after a few minutes. Can't say that she's actually overheating cuz nothing seems to boil/pour outta the radiator with the cap off, and it doesn't BEHAVE as though it's overheating. Might just need a new sending unit.

Still gonna have to work out some bugs too; dash lights don't work, front turn signals don't work, small things really.

She's still ugly as all outdoors, but I'm looking forward to driving her around some this weekend.
